Hey Tom, here's a quickie of a T34 I recently did a bit of work to for a customer. They are pretty tight inside, but you can get a clark in there with no problem. I'd advise the conversion to lipo, though, as that 1700 nimh battery really isn't much good. This tank is still on stock electronics.



Hope that helps.
